CetrelSecurities and Aim Software Acquire First Joint Customer

CetrelSecurities, a specialist in providing ASP services to financial institutions with more than 20 active clients using the service, and Aim Software, a global provider of reference data management solutions to the financial industry, today announced that they have acquired a first common customer based on Aim Software’s Gain Golden Copy.

Being a regulated company controlled by the Luxembourg Financial Markets Authority, CetrelSecurities, a subsidiary of the Luxembourg based Cetrel, focuses on the provision of ASP services in the area of pricing, reference data and corporate actions management to financial institutions all over Europe.

In order to fulfil the specific requirements of one of its major European customers, CetrelSecurities has chosen Gain Golden Copy from Aim Software. Both companies’ profound experience in the area of data management as well as their integration capabilities related to standard banking packages will ensure an optimum data quality and customer support for CetrelSecurities’ clients.

CetrelSecurities’ customer will be able to benefit directly from the access to Aim Software’s proven Gain Data Management platform with more than 108 references, while being spared the effort of installing and maintaining it in-house. By relying on an outsourced service, this client will be able to increase its operational efficiency and to concentrate on its core business at the same time. Carlo Houblie, executive vice president of CetrelSecurities explains: “Aim Software‘s flexible reference data solution as well as CetrelSecurities know how in the area of ASP Provision complement each another in an ideal way. By being able to built on product components such as 15+ maintained datafeed connectors and on a highly secured production environment, CetrelSecurities and Aim Software are able to provide a high quality tailor-made data service.”

“We are proud that our Gain Golden Copy will be used for the delivery of reference data services at one of the major ASP providers in Europe,” adds Josef Sommeregger, vice president business development and sales at Aim Software.” Our strong local presence in Luxembourg will serve as a basis for a future cooperation with CetrelSecurities allowing both companies to focus on their core competencies.”

“We are extremely pleased about this important stride in CetrelSecurities’ history,” concludes Renaud Oury, executive vice president of CetrelSecurities. “We are convinced that our joint know-how and expertise will help our clients to increase the reliability and quality of their overall reference data management, effectively cut down their costs, while reducing their operational risks.“
